i searched a bit and couldn't find anything so here goes...92 XJ 4.0 HO auto tranny, just replaced the head gasket for the 2nd time, first time doing it i was stupid and screwed up, replaced it and its great now, everythings fine, except the temp gauge doesn't work. I replaced the temp sender unit the first time i did it, but it might have been damaged on the 2nd time. I checked the continuity on the wire and it has continutiy, and everytime i turn the ign. on the gauge goes all the way to hot and then goes back down. any ideas?

If the engine is hot, it will show a relatively low resistance (under 1000 ohms). If the engine is cool, it will show a relatively larger resistance (over 1000ohms) . Either case shows "continuity".

How soon does it go back down? How far down does it go?

Maybe you whacked the wiring when you pulled the head.

also make sure that u properly filled and "burped" the coolant system of air. a temp gauge won't read if it has an air pocket around it.
